The ever-evolving dining enclave of Dempsey Hill is set abuzz with the entry of MOONBOW, a beautiful new restaurant that specialises in modern European cuisine with an Asian accent.

Conceptualised by its co-owners Dylan Soh and Chef Heman Tan, diners can expect every step of the MOONBOW experience to be a picture-perfect moment, from the enthralling interior awashed in pastel and champagne hues, to the delectable dishes served on vibrant ceramic tableware designed by the artistically-inclined chef. MOONBOW takes its name from the rare, natural phenomena, also known as a lunar rainbow.

As moonbows are often regarded as a symbol of hope during difficult times, it is a fitting name for the restaurant, which was Chef Heman’s beacon of light amidst the past year's challenges.

The adventure begins as guests are ushered into the spacious dining area with a high ceiling where they are greeted with soft pastel hues of champagne and blush that are juxtaposed with accents of gold. Put together by the co-owners, the interiors come together to create a sense of timeless elegance.

A striking centrepiece, a feature wall showcases a 4.3m tall tree meticulously pieced together from separate, naturally dried branches collected in a private garden. Each branch is adorned with magnolia flowers, tastefully matching the dining space interspersed with blooms of orchids.

Moonbow

A glass wall separates the main dining area from the kitchen, where guests can witness Chef Heman and his team in action while savouring the delicious creations. The 4,500 sq ft venue also houses a private dining room which seats eight people, perfect for intimate meals with friends and family.

Past the handsome forest green bar with its matching marble countertop is a small doorway that leads to the patio. Overlooking an expansive field, the patio evokes a sense of calm and beckons guests to slow down and take a breather. Here, pastel tones give way to rustic rattan and wooden touches, and when night falls, the overhanging lanterns come to life, enveloping the space in a soft ambient glow.

With over 38 years of culinary experience, Chef Heman seamlessly merges his love for Asian ingredients and Western cooking techniques. The menu reflects heartwarming snippets of his culinary journey along with contemporary interpretations of dishes that he enjoys cooking for his family.

Savour an array of starters such as the Garden of Escargot ($23++) with fresh micro cress, truffle gelato, lychee pearl, mushroom oil, and mashed edamame. Best eaten by combining the different elements of the dish together in a single bite, Chef Heman was inspired to create this dish after observing snails in the park during a particular rainy day.

Moonbow

Alternatively, try the delicate Moonbow Oyster Bay ($10++ per piece), featuring Fine de Claire oysters served with oyster leaves, yuzu gel, cucumber pearl, and yuzu granita. Refreshed, elevated takes on treasured home recipes include the Black Berry 4-Grain Healthy Rice. Comprising a blend of four different grains - black berry rice, red rice, barley and pearl rice - the dish was first created for his diabetic mother.

At MOONBOW, the 4-grain rice is mixed with olive leaves and Chinese lap cheong sausage for added bite, and paired with either roasted pork jowl “Ton Toro'' ($38++) or “Impossible” meat patties ($28++). A dish that will evoke emotional memories is the Black Silkie Poulet ($38++) where Black Silkie Chicken leg is char grilled and served with garlicky crumb, bearnaise sauce, wolfberry mash, black garlic purée, heirloom tomatoes, and chives.

The creation was inspired by his wife who craved for sesame chicken during her confinement. Chef Heman could only find black chicken during one visit to the wet market but the dish turned out well. Since then, Chef Heman has been experimenting with different techniques to cook black chicken.

Other highlights include the Fermented Red Yeast Wine ($38++) which comprises fermented red glutinous rice wine and oyster mushroom, served with Filet de Barramundi, and the Tomahawk de Swine ($68++), a specialty unique to MOONBOW as it is the only restaurant in Singapore to use an untrimmed tomahawk chop from a 9- to 10-month young pig.

Aged for four days, the succulent cut is served with roasted garlic, caramelised lime, pineapple compote and a homemade BBQ glaze. An accomplished ceramicist, Chef Heman channels his creative energy into enhancing diners’ experience with custom-made ceramic plates. A reflection of his optimistic outlook on life, the colourful tableware pairs beautifully with the dishes and is an integral element of the MOONBOW experience.
